-
Forum: Sonstige Fragen zu Delphi
by timsen96,
27. Mai 2017
Hmm ok, also gibt es keine andere Möglichkeit....
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
27. Mai 2017
Kann ich da denn einstellen das es im Steamverzeichnis landet?
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
27. Mai 2017
Ich meine sowas wie eine Mod, wo die Dateien ins Installationsverzeichnis muss.
Gibt es da eine Möglichkeit das man sagt: Das Setup soll im Steam Pfad von "Spiel XY" installiert werden, auch wenn man bei Steam die Einstellungen verstellt hat, sodass die Steam Spiele nicht im Standard Verzeichnis ist?
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
27. Mai 2017
Hmm ok, werde ich mal schauen, aber ich hätte da auch noch kurz eine andere Frage.
Ich hätte demnächst auch was mit einem Spiel vor, kann man denn bei so etwas dann den Pfad über Steam wählen?
Bei Steam kann man ja auch sagen ich möchte, das meine Spiele woanders installiert werden, gibt es dort eine Möglichkeit?
Wenn nicht dann ist es auch egal :D
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
27. Mai 2017
Danke euch für die ganze Hilfe!!
Aber so langsam versteh ich garnichts mehr :(
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
26. Mai 2017
Wieso denn angemeckert? Ist doch alles gut :-D Ich bin froh das mir jemand überhaupt versucht zu helfen ;-)
Danke dafür erstmal!
Ich habe im Internet gesucht und es kopiert aber natürlich mach ich mir selber Gedanken, nur mein Wissen ist noch nicht sehr weit...
In der Registry ist das das einzige was ich finden kann, sonst gibt es keine Einträge. Ich dachte man könnte über den Wert an den...
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
26. Mai 2017
Ich habe es mal über die Registry probiert.
DefaultDirName={code:GetRegistryPath}
function GetRegistryPath(DefaultPath: string): string;
begin
if not RegQueryStringValue(HKEY_CURRENT_USER, 'Software\Classes\Local Settings\Software\Microsoft\Windows\Shell\MuiCache', 'TestProgramm', Result) then Result := ExpandConstant(DefaultPath);
end;
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Versteh ich nicht. Es muss ja nicht unbedingt die .exe überprüft werden, es kann ja auch eine x Beliebige Datei sein z.B. eine Textdatei. Wie mache ich es bei Inno Setup das Beispielweise die Installation guckt ob auf dem Desktop die Datei Xy.txt existiert.
Wenn ja dann soll die Installation ihre Dateien in einem Ordner auf dem Desktop einfügen.
Falls die Xy.txt auf dem Desktop NICHT vorhanden...
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Das Programm! Aber ich habe Zusätzliche Sachen gemacht die für das Programm nützlich sind...
Also Leute kaufen sich das Programm.
Und wenn manche die Zusatzinhalte von mir möchten, können sie es Kostenlos holen.
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Ihr versteht mich nicht!... Ich will nix verkaufen und auch nichts mit Lizenzen machen. Ich möchte doch nur den Zusatzinhalt kostenlos anbieten, für Leute die es sich gekauft haben.
Das heißt für diejenigen die es nicht besitzen, können damit rein garnichts anfangen.
Das hat ja auch nichts mehr mit meiner eigentlichen Frage zutun, ich wollte nur wissen wie man die Möglichkeit bei Inno Setup...
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Sind für alle, nur ich kann ja kein komplettes Programm was Geld kostet zusammen Anbieten, weil es könnten dann ja auch Leute bekommen die sich es nicht gekauft haben... Ich möchte es nur für die Leute, die es sich gekauft haben, deshalb das komplette anzubieten kommt nicht in Frage...
Ich habe was im Internet gefunden:
"
function NextButtonClick(PageId: Integer): Boolean;
begin
Result...
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Es sind Zusatzdateien und andere Sprachen. Alles zusammen mit dem Programm verpacken kann ich nicht weil es auch für andere Leute sein soll und die haben es sich bereits gekauft. Aber was gibt es denn für eine alternative damit ich die Dateien in das Verzeichnis bekomme wo das Programm bereits installiert ist? Ist es nicht irgendwie möglich das man anstatt der eigenen erstellten Fehlermeldung...
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Das ist das was ich habe:
"
Source: "C:\Quelldatei"; DestDir: "{app}"; Flags: ignoreversion;
; NOTE: Don't use "Flags: ignoreversion" on any shared system files
function InitializeSetup(): Boolean;
begin
if (FileExists('C:\Program Files (x86)\TestProgramm\Test.exe')) then
begin
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Ich meine damit, dass wenn die Datei existiert die Dateien von der Installation in einem vorhandenen Unterordner installiert werden.
z.B.:
C:\Programme\TestProgramm\
Und dort ist die Test.exe und weitere Ordner (TestOrdner1,TestOrdner2)
Wenn die Test.exe existiert dann sollen die Dateien von der Installation in den vorhandenen TestOrdnet1 rein.
-
Forum: Sonstige Fragen zu Delphi
by timsen96,
25. Mai 2017
Ich möchte das vor der Installation überprüft wird ob die Datei Test.exe vorhanden ist, wenn ja soll die Installation in einem Unterordner im gleichen Pfad wo sich die Test.exe befindet die ausgeführt werden. Wenn die Test.exe nicht vorhanden ist, dann möchte ich das ich eine Mitteilung bekomme und ich den Pfad der Test.exe selbst suchen kann....
Bis jetzt habe ich es nur hinbekommen, das er die...